Racing the Light

by Robert Crais

Part of Elvis Cole and Joe Pike, book 19

First published 2022

Elvis Cole takes what seems like a straightforward missing person case when Adele Schumacher hires him to locate her son Josh Shoe. But Adele arrives with a bag of cash, wild conspiracy theories, and armed bodyguards. Her son Josh hosts a controversial podcast and has vanished along with his girlfriend, an adult film actress. Elvis discovers he's not the only one searching for the couple. A team of killers wants to find Josh first, and they're watching Elvis's every move. As the detective digs deeper, he uncovers connections to crooked politicians and violent business cartels that have infected Los Angeles from the inside. Elvis calls on his partner Joe Pike to help navigate the web of lies and lethal secrets. The case becomes personal when Lucy Chenier and her son Ben return to his life. Elvis realizes how much he stands to lose if he can't solve the mystery and survive the people who want Josh silenced forever.
